Kathmandu, March 21
Chinese Foreign Affairs Minister Wang Yi is visiting Nepal on March 25, confirms the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
Wang is coming to Nepal at the invitation of Foreign Minister Narayan Khadka,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s informed on Monday.
During his visit to Nepal, Foreign Minister Wang will pay a courtesy call on President Bidya Devi Bhandari and Prime Minister Sher Bahadur Deuba. Similarly, he will hold bilateral talks with Minister Khadka on Saturday, March 26.
During the visit, Wang Yi is also scheduled to hold talks with former Prime Minister and UML
Chairman KP Sharma Oli and CPN (Maoist Centre) Chairman Prachanda.
Observers have been keenly looking at the visit as China has been repeatedly objecting to
Nepal’s endorsement of the US government’s MCC deal recently.
